﻿body {
	font: "sans-serif","微软雅黑";
	font-size: 14px;
}

/**贷款计算器**/
.a-dk{ border-bottom:#CCC 1px solid; margin-bottom:20px; padding:20px 0; height:40px;}
.a-dk span > span{ font-size:24px; margin-left:20px;}
.dk-an{ border:#e89e86 1px solid; background:url(../images/dkjsq.png) no-repeat 2px 2px;background-image:url(../images/dkjsq.png); background-size:27px 27px; width:110px; height:31px; line-height:31px; display:block; text-align:right; padding:0 10px 0 0; border-radius:4px;}
.dk-an:hover{background-color:#fcf0f0;background-image:url(../images/dkjsq.png);background-size:27px 27px;}
/**咨询热线**/
.zxrx{ border-top:#CCC 1px solid; padding:26px 0 0 0; margin-top:50px; line-height:30px;}
.zxrx span{ color:#e85045; font-weight:600; font-size:16px; margin-left:20px; font-size:24px; }



/*区域介绍*/
.area_box {width: 100%;height: 225px;margin: 0 auto;}
.area_intro {display: inline-block;float: left;width: 350px;height: 200px;}
.area_intro>div {width: 312px;height: 84px;border: 1px solid #E5E5E5;text-align: left;line-height: 84px;padding: 0px 0px 0px 30px;letter-spacing: 2px;}
.area_intro>div:first-of-type {margin-top: 15px;}
.area_intro>div:last-child {margin-top: 30px;}
span.area_price {font-size: 24px;color: #ff9a00;font-weight: 600;}
.area_chart {display: inline-block;float: left;width: 340px;height: 225px;}
.area_list_box {display: inline-block;float: right;width: 345px;height: auto;}
.area_list_box>ul {width: 100%;list-style: none;}
.area_list_box>ul>li {width: 100%;height: 44px;border-bottom: 1px solid #E5E5E5;line-height: 44px;}
.area_list_box>ul>li>span.area_list_icon {display:inline-block;width: 12px;height: 12px;margin-right: 25px;}
.area_list_icon01 {background: #5a9afe;}
.area_list_icon02 {background: #feda3b;}
.area_list_icon03 {background: #8b642d;}
.area_list_icon04 {background: #f8964d;}
.area_list_icon05 {background: #2cdd99;}
span.area_list_per {float: right;}


/*学区信息*/
table { background-color: transparent }
table { border-collapse:collapse; border-spacing:0; }
th,td { padding: 0; }
caption { padding-top: 8px; padding-bottom: 8px; color: #777; text-align: left }
th { text-align: center }
.table { width: 100%; max-width: 100%; margin-top:30px;margin-bottom: 20px;cursor: pointer; }
.table>thead>tr>th, .table>tbody>tr>th, .table>tfoot>tr>th, .table>thead>tr>td, .table>tbody>tr>td, .table>tfoot>tr>td { padding: 8px; line-height: 1.42857143; vertical-align: center; border-top: 1px solid #ddd; text-align:center }
.table>thead>tr>th { vertical-align: bottom; border-bottom: 2px solid #ddd }
.table>caption+thead>tr:first-child>th, .table>colgroup+thead>tr:first-child>th, .table>thead:first-child>tr:first-child>th, .table>caption+thead>tr:first-child>td, 
.table>colgroup+thead>tr:first-child>td, .table>thead:first-child>tr:first-child>td { border-top: 0 }
.table>tbody+tbody { border-top: 2px solid #ddd }
.table { background-color: #fff }
.table>tbody>tr>td:first-of-type {text-align: left;width: 520px;}
.table>thead>tr {height: 45px;}
.table>tbody>tr {height: 52px;}
.table-bordered { border: 1px solid #ddd }
.table-bordered>thead>tr>th, .table-bordered>tbody>tr>th, .table-bordered>tfoot>tr>th, .table-bordered>thead>tr>td, .table-bordered>tbody>tr>td, .table-bordered>tfoot>tr>td { border: 1px solid #ddd }
.table-bordered>thead>tr>th, .table-bordered>thead>tr>td { border-bottom-width: 2px }
.table-hover>tbody>tr:hover { background-color: #f5f5f5 }
.table>tbody>tr>td {font-weight: 600;}
.score {margin:0px 30px 0px 50px;display:inline-block;width: 28px;height: 28px;color: #FFFFFF;border-radius: 50%;text-align: center;line-height: 28px;vertical-align: middle;}
.score_green {background: #2dcb00;}
.score_orange {background: #ff9205;}

/*历史交易*/
.trade_box { width: 1040px; height: 80px; margin: 0 auto; cursor: auto}
.trade_box>div {display:inline-block;width: 500px;height: 75px;background: #f4f4f4;border: 1px solid #dbdbdb;text-align: center;line-height: 75px;vertical-align: middle;transition: all .4s ease-in-out;}
.trade_box>div.trade_box_01 {float: left;}
.trade_box>div.trade_box_02 {float: right;}
.trade_box_info {margin-left: 18px;font-size: 24px;font-weight: 600;cursor: pointer;}
.trade_box>div:hover {background: #EEEEEE;}

/*贷款计算器*/
select {margin: 0;padding: 0;appearance:none;-moz-appearance:none;-webkit-appearance:none;}
.bei_counter { width: 1032px; height: 392px; border: 4px solid #eff0f2; font-size: 14px;}
.count_box { display:inline-block;float:left;width: 380px; height: auto;padding: 60px 0px 0px 20px;}
.count_box_01 {height: 36px;width: 360px;box-sizing: border-box;margin-bottom: 20px;}
.count_box_02 {height: 50px;width: 360px;box-sizing: border-box;margin-bottom: 20px;}
.count_box_01 label,
.count_box_02 label {display: inline-block;width: 100px;height: 36px;vertical-align: middle;text-align: right;line-height: 36px;margin-right: 20px;}
.count_box_01 input,
.count_box_02 input {display:inline-block;width: 198px;height: 34px;border: 1px solid #EFF0F2;padding-left: 10px;font-size: 16px;font-weight: 600;box-sizing: border-box;outline: none;}
.count_box_01 select {outline: none;}
.count_box_01 input:focus,
.count_box_02 input:focus,
.count-box_01 select {border: 1px solid #ccc;box-shadow: 0px 0px 8px #ccc;}
.count_box_01 select,
.count_box_02 select { appearance:none;-moz-appearance:none;-webkit-appearance:none;display:inline-block;width: 198px;height: 34px;border: 1px solid #EFF0F2;padding:0px 0px 0px 10px;font-size: 16px;font-weight: 600;background: url(../iamges/count_icon_list.png) no-repeat scroll right center transparent;}
.count_box_02 p {width: 200px;text-align: left;margin-left:130px;color: #FF0000;}
option:focus { appearance:none;-moz-appearance:none;-webkit-appearance:none;background: #C0C0C0;color: #FFFFFF}
select::-ms-expand { display: none; }


/*echarts环形图*/
.count_chart {display:inline-block;float:left;width: 380px;height: 380px;}

/*echarts环形图数据显示*/
.count_info {display:inline-block;float:right;width: 250px;height: auto;padding: 90px 0px 0px 0px;font-size: 16px;color: #8f8f8f;}
.count_info_01,.count_info_02,.count_info_03 {width: 200px;height: 50px;line-height: 50px;}
.count_info_01>span:first-of-type {display: inline-block;width: 14px;height: 14px;border-radius: 50%;background: #5a9afe;margin-right: 10px;}
.count_info_01>span:last-of-type {display: inline-block;float:right;width: 80px;height: 50px;line-height: 50px;color: #333;font-weight: 600;}
.count_info_02>span:first-of-type {display: inline-block;width: 14px;height: 14px;border-radius: 50%;background: #fe7458;margin-right: 10px;}
.count_info_02>span:last-of-type {display: inline-block;float:right;width: 80px;height: 50px;line-height: 50px;color: #333;font-weight: 600;}
.count_info_03>span:first-of-type {display: inline-block;width: 14px;height: 14px;border-radius: 50%;background: #6ee043;margin-right: 10px;}
.count_info_03>span:last-of-type {display: inline-block;float:right;width: 80px;height: 50px;line-height: 50px;color: #333;font-weight: 600;}
.count_info a {display: block;width: 192px;height: 40px;background: #fd8f2d;border: 4px solid #FD8F2D;text-align: center;line-height: 40px;color: white;margin-top: 50px; -webkit-transition: all .5s ease-in-out; -moz-transition: all .5s ease-in-out; -ms-transition: all .5s ease-in-out; -o-transition: all .5s ease-in-out; transition: all .5s ease-in-out; }
.count_info a:hover {background: #FFFFFF;color:#333;-webkit-transition: all .5s ease-in-out; -moz-transition: all .5s ease-in-out; -ms-transition: all .5s ease-in-out; -o-transition: all .5s ease-in-out; transition: all .5s ease-in-out;}

/*vue动态绑定表单*/
[v-cloak] {
  display: none !important;
}